    Personally...I would not purchase likes because Facebook still control who see's your content. A lot of people who liked your page will still rarely see your post on their wall.

    Instead I would purchase clicks to websites or, even better, Video ads from facebook.

    Last time I checked the Facebook Video ads were the cheapest way to advertise on Facebook.

    Well of course it is possible, it's not like you tested all interest/behaviors/demographics. But you should pay for likes just to get things started. Like webmarke said, very few of those people are going to see your posts. Unless of course you pay to promote your post to fans.

    If you need likes, instead of paying for them just make some good posts that get a decent number of likes. You can invite those people to also like your page.
